@charset "utf-8";
/* CSS Document */

.main-article-column{
width:495px;
float:left;
}

.main-article{
width:495px;
background-image:url(../images/article-box-bg.jpg);
background-repeat:repeat-y;
float:left;
}

.main-article-category{
width:495px;
float:left;
}

.article-header{
width:741px;
height:71px;
background:url(http://www.thesurvivorsclub.org/images/h1-article-bg.png) no-repeat ;
background-position:right;
color:#cc0000;
 

}

.article-header-article{
width:713px;
height:71px;
background:url(http://www.thesurvivorsclub.org/images/h1-article-bg.png) repeat-y ;
background-position:right;
color:#cc0000;
margin-bottom:13px;
 

}

.article-header h1{
font-family:Georgia, 'Times New Roman', Times, serif;
font-style:italic;
font-size:30px;
margin-top:0px;
margin-bottom:0px
}

.article-header-article h1{
font-family:Georgia, 'Times New Roman', Times, serif;
font-style:italic;
font-size:24px;
margin-top:0px;
margin-bottom:0px
}

.category-header-wrapper{
margin-top:17px;
float:left;
margin-left:27px;
}

.article-header-wrapper{
margin-top:19px;
float:left;
margin-left:0px;
}

.article-support-center{
margin-top:22px;
float:left;
padding:2px;
margin-left:15px;
}





.main-article li{
list-style-image:url(../images/article-list-image.jpg);
line-height:16px;
margin-left:5px;
}

.main-article ul{
margin:10px 10px 10px 15px;
padding:0px;

}

.main-article h3{
font:Arial, Helvetica, sans-serif;
font-family:Arial, Helvetica, sans-serif;
font-size:14px;
font-weight:bold;
margin:0;
padding:0;
color:#cc0000;
}

.main-article h2{
font:Arial, Helvetica, sans-serif;
font-family:Arial, Helvetica, sans-serif;
font-size:14px;
font-weight:bold;
color:#000;
}

.main-article li{
list-style-image:url(../images/article-list-image.jpg);
line-height:16px;
margin-left:5px;
}

.main-article-category ul{
margin:10px 10px 10px 15px;
padding:0px;

}

.main-article-category h3{
font:Arial, Helvetica, sans-serif;
font-family:Arial, Helvetica, sans-serif;
font-size:14px;
font-weight:bold;
margin:0;
padding:0;
color:#cc0000;
}

.main-article-category h2{
font:Arial, Helvetica, sans-serif;
font-family:Arial, Helvetica, sans-serif;
font-size:14px;
font-weight:bold;
color:#000;
}


.main-article-top{
width:100%;
background-image:url(../images/article-box-top-2.jpg);
background-repeat:no-repeat;
height:15px;
}

.main-article-top h3{
float:left;
}

.main-article-stripes{
background-image:url(../images/header-stripe.png);
background-repeat:repeat;
margin-left:8px;
width:469px;
padding:10px 0px 10px 10px;
}
.main-article-stripes h3{
float:left;
}

.main-article-stripes-first{
background-image:url(../images/header-stripe.png);
background-repeat:repeat;
margin-left:8px;
width:469px;
padding:0px 0px 10px 10px;
}

.main-article-stripes-first h3{
float:left;
}

.to-top, .to-top a, .to-top a:hover, .to-top a:visited  {
font-size:10px;
float:right;
color:#cc0000 !important;
text-decoration:underline;
margin-right:5px;
}


.main-article-bottom{
width:100%;
background-image:url(../images/article-box-bottom.jpg);
background-repeat:no-repeat;
height:13px;
}

.main-article-text{
margin:10px 15px 15px 20px;
padding: 0px 7px 0px 7px;
}

.main-article img {
	padding: 0px 0px 0px 0px;
	margin: 0px 0px 0px 0px;
}

.main-article-text h3{
margin-top:25px;
color:#000;
margin-bottom:0px;
}

.main-article-text h4{
margin-top:10px;
color:#000;
margin-bottom:0px;
}

.main-article-text h2{
margin-top:10px;
width:100%
}

/*right box*/

.main-article-right{
float:left;
margin-left:7px;
}

.main-article-right-category{
float:left;
margin-left:30px;
}


.right-article-toplinks {
width:184px;
font-size:11px;
margin-bottom:0px;
padding:10px;
background-image:url(http://www.thesurvivorsclub.org/images/support-center-link-bg.jpg);
background-repeat:no-repeat;
}

.right-article-toplinks a, .right-article-toplinks a:visited{
width:196px;
font-size:11px;
color: #cc0000 !important;
;

}


.right-article{
width:196px;
background-image:url(../images/article-right-bg.jpg);
background-repeat:repeat-y;
font-size:12px;
color:#333333;
line-height:16px;
margin-bottom:10px;
}

.right-article-top{
width:100%;
background-image:url(../images/article-right-box-top.jpg);
background-repeat:no-repeat;
height:7px;
margin:0px;
}

.right-article-header{
width:194px;
background-image:url(../images/article-right-header-bg.jpg);
background-repeat:repeat-x;
margin:0px 1px 0px 1px;
padding-bottom:10px;
float:left;
background-color:#dadada;

}
.right-article-header h3{
font:Georgia, "Times New Roman", Times, serif;
font-family:Georgia, "Times New Roman", Times, serif;
font-size:14px;
font-weight:bold;
color:#cc0000;
font-style:italic;
padding:0px;
margin:0px;
width:150px;
}


.right-article-bottom{
width:100%;
background-image:url(../images/article-box-right-bottom.jpg);
background-repeat:no-repeat;
height:6px;
}

.right-text{
padding:10px;

}

.right-wrapper{
float:left;
padding:2px 0px 5px 5px;
}

/*category*/

#category-grey{
background-image: url(../images/grey-bg.jpg);
background-repeat:repeat-y;
width:721px;
float:left;
margin-bottom:15px;
padding:10px 0px 10px 20px;
}

#daily-updates-header{
width:469px;
background-image: url(../images/daily-health-updates.jpg);
background-repeat:no-repeat;
height:45px;
padding:7px 0px 0px 40px
}

#daily-updates-header h3{
font:Georgia, "Times New Roman", Times, serif;
font-family:Georgia, "Times New Roman", Times, serif;
font-size:16px;
font-style:italic;
font-weight:bold;
margin-top:4px;

}

#daily-updates-bg{
width:509px;
background-image: url(../images/daily-health-updates-bg-2.jpg);
background-repeat:repeat-y;
}

#daily-updates-bottom{
width:509px;
background-image: url(../images/daily-health-updates-bottom.jpg);
background-repeat:no-repeat;
height:8px
}

#category-main-box-header{
width:497px;
height:16px;
background-image: url(../images/category-main-box-top.png);
background-repeat:no-repeat;


}

#category-main-box-bg{
width:497px;
background-image: url(../images/category-main-box-bg.png);
background-repeat:repeat-y;
height:276px;

}

#category-main-box-bottom{
width:497px;
height:16px;
background-image: url(../images/category-main-box-bottom.png);
background-repeat:no-repeat;

}

#category-main-inner{
width:450px;
padding:5px 5px 5px 25px;
}

.img-left{
float:left;
width:10%;
}

.text-right{
float:left;
width:90%
}

.number-item{
margin-bottom:10px;
}

#update-box{
margin-left:25px;
}

.update-box-wrapper{
float:left;
margin:10px 0px 0px 10px;
width:211px;
}

.update-box-wrapper-left{
float:left;
margin:10px 0px 0px 25px;
width:211px;
}

.update-box-top{
background-image:url(../images/updates-box-top.jpg);
background-repeat:no-repeat;
width:218px;
height:28px;
padding:8px 0px 0px 10px;
}

.update-box-bg{
background-image:url(../images/update-box-bg.jpg);
background-repeat:repeat-y;
width:214px;
height:295px;
padding:7px;
line-height:18px;

}

.update-box-bg li{
list-style-image:url(../images/article-list-image.jpg);
line-height:16px;
margin-left:5px;
color:#cc0000;
}

.update-box-bg ul{
margin:0px 10px 10px 15px;
padding:0px;

}

.update-box-bg a,.update-box-bg a:visited{
text-decoration:underline;
color:#cc0000;
}

.update-box-top h3{
font-size:14px;
font-weight:bold;
font:Arial, Helvetica, sans-serif;
}

.update-box-bottom{
background-image:url(../images/update-box-bottom.jpg);
background-repeat:no-repeat;
width:228px;
height:13px;
}

#view-profile-button{
background-image:url(../images/view-profile-button.jpg);
width:183px;
height:34px;
color:#FFFFFF;
font-weight:bold;
padding-top:10px;
text-align:center
}

#category-4-box-header{
width:211px;
height:15px;
background-image: url(../images/category-4-top.png);
background-repeat:no-repeat;
font:Georgia, "Times New Roman", Times, serif;
font-family:Georgia, "Times New Roman", Times, serif;
font-weight:bold;
color:#FFFFFF;
}

#category-4-box-bg{
width:211px;
background-image: url(../images/category-4-bg.png);
background-repeat:repeat-y;
height:235px;
}

#category-4-box-bottom{
width:211px;
height:42px;
background-image: url(../images/category-4-bottom.png);
background-repeat:no-repeat;
padding-top:12px;
text-align:center
}

#category-4-box-bottom a, #category-4-box-bottom a:visited{
color:#FFFFFF;
text-decoration:underline;
font:11px;
font-weight:bold;
}

.category-home-number{
margin-bottom:15px;
}

.category-home-img{
margin-right:10px;
}

.category-image{
width:10%;
float:left
}

.category-list{
width:90%;
float:left
}


/*start slider category*/

#category-left{
float:left;
}

#category-left ul{
margin-left:0px;
padding-left:0px;
list-style:inside;
margin-top:5px;
}

#category-left li{
margin-left:0px;
padding-left:0px
}


.paginationstyle{ /*Style for demo pagination divs*/
width: 145px;
text-align: left;
padding: 2px 0;
margin: 0px 0 0px 15px;;
display:block;
float:left
}

.paginationstyle select{ /*Style for demo pagination divs' select menu*/
margin: 0 15px;
}

.paginationstyle a{ /*Pagination links style*/
text-decoration: none;
display:block;
background-image:url(/images/4-findsomeone.jpg);
display:block;
width:155px;
height:28px;
text-decoration:none;
padding:13px 0px 0px 25px;
color:#cc0000;
font-weight:bold;
margin-bottom:5px;
}

.paginationstyle a:hover, .paginationstyle a.selected{
background-image:url(/images/4-findsomeone-over.jpg);
display:block;
width:155px;
height:28px;
text-decoration:none;
padding:13px 0px 0px 25px;
color:#cc0000;
}


/*sub nav bar */

.journey{
width:486px;
font:Georgia, "Times New Roman", Times, serif;
font-size:10px;
color:#cc0000;
font-family:Georgia, "Times New Roman", Times, serif;
margin:0px 0px 10px 5px;

}

.journey a{
text-decoration:none;
font:Georgia, "Times New Roman", Times, serif;
font-size:10px;
color:#cc0000;
font-family:Georgia, "Times New Roman", Times, serif;
}

.journey-end{
display:block;
float:left;
height:46px;
background-image:url(../images/left.jpg);
width:135px;
font-size:16px;
color:#333333;
font-weight:bold;
font-style:italic;
vertical-align:middle;
text-align:center;
padding-top:20px;
}

.journey-item-1{
display:block;
float:left;
height:66px;
background-image:url(../images/just-found-out.jpg);
width:83px;
}

.journey-item-1 a{
display:block;
float:left;
background-image:url(../images/just-found-out.jpg);
width:83px;
padding-top:5px;
height:61px;
}

.journey-item-1 a:hover{
display:block;
float:left;
height:66px;
background-image: url(../images/just-found-out-over.jpg);
width:83px;
padding-top:5px;
height:61px;
}

.journey-item-2{
display:block;
float:left;
background-image: url(../images/dealing.jpg);
width:99px;
}

.journey-item-2 a{
display:block;
float:left;
padding-top:5px;
height:61px;
background-image: url(../images/dealing.jpg);
width:92px;
padding-left:7px;
}

.journey-item-2 a:hover{
display:block;
float:left;
padding-top:5px;
height:61px;
background-image: url(../images/dealing-over.jpg);
width:92px;
padding-left:7px;
}

.journey-item-3 {
display:block;
float:left;
height:66px;
background-image: url(../images/recovery.jpg);
width:97px;
}

.journey-item-3 a{
display:block;
float:left;
padding-top:5px;
height:61px;
background-image: url(../images/recovery.jpg);
width:92px;
padding-left:5px
}

.journey-item-3 a:hover{
display:block;
float:left;
padding-top:5px;
height:61px;
background-image: url(../images/recovery-over.jpg);
width:92px;
padding-left:5px
}

.journey-item-4 {
display:block;
float:left;
height:66px;
background-image: url(../images/worst.jpg);
width:72px;
}

.journey-item-4 a{
display:block;
float:left;
padding-top:5px;
height:61px;
background-image: url(../images/worst-case.jpg);
background-repeat:no-repeat;
width:60px;
padding-left:12px;
}

.journey-item-4 a:hover{
display:block;
float:left;
padding-top:5px;
height:61px;
background-image: url(../images/worst-case-over.jpg);
background-repeat:no-repeat;
width:60px;
padding-left:12px;
}



